โฆ Synopsis
The influence of stress ratio R and yield strength uY on crack closure and fatigue crack growth were studied. Crack closure and crack growth experiments were performed on 6063-T6 and 606I-T6 Al-alloys of O%, 2%, 3% and 6% prestrains. Crack closure stresses were measured using a side edge measurement technique with a clip on displacement gauge. The gauge was placed across the side Edge Notch of the specimen. It was found that after crack initiation the crack closure stabilized. The closure load was however found to be function of R and oY. Fatigue crack growth rate is found to be dependent upon R, U and AK. A model Cl and da/dN has been developed.
